Ernest Mathieu Obituary

Ernest A. Mathieu

ACTON - Ernest A. Mathieu, 63, of Acton, died in Sanford on Tuesday, May 13, 2014.

Ernest was born on Oct. 24, 1950 to Robert and Isabelle (Livingstone) Mathieu in Sanford, where he grew up and attended local schools, graduating from Sanford High School in 1969.

He was employed for 20 years as a machinist at Pratt and Whitney until his retirement in 2000.

Ernest was a horse enthusiast and enjoyed driving and training horses. He was an avid outdoorsman and enjoyed cutting wood, hunting and fishing. He was also a very handy person and enjoyed tinkering with small engines.

Spending time with family and attending family gatherings were things that Ernest always looked forward to. He was also an animal lover and enjoyed watching sports.

Ernest will be remembered as a loving and devoted father, grandfather and brother and will be dearly missed by his family and friends.

Surviving are two children, Ernest Mathieu, Jr., and his wife, Julia, of Acton, and Joanne Murray, of Sanford; two stepchildren, Kimberly M. Stanley and her husband, Scott Harland Stanley, of Sanford, and John David Murray and his wife, Denise Lynn Murray, of Sanford; five grandchildren, Cameron Alan Mathieu, Jacob Liston, Zachary Bickford, Jesse Robert Burley and Ryan David Murray; several great grandchildren; a sister, Susan Mathieu, of Wakefield, N.H.; several aunts, uncles and cousins; and his beloved pets.

A memorial service was held on Sunday, May 18, at the Acton Congregational Church, with the Rev. Abbylynn Haskell officiating.

Arrangements are under the direction of Black Funeral Homes and Cremation Service, Sanford-Springvale.
